Making the buzz

With my friend Boogii, after the market on Sunday, we have done some Buzz.
You remember the traditional food in Mongolia.
Now here is the receipt: -)

The first ingredient is just flour  that you mix with water, that's it.
Not very complicated.
Let it rest for a while...
See the technic for the mixing:



Then you need 2 more ingredient.
A very big piece of meat.
Most of the time in Mongolia it's frozen. Because people buy a lot at the market and keep it for a long time.
So this one was frozen, but the expert Boogii is chopping it perfectly.

The next ingredient is new onions.
I have chopped this one.
Look at the beautiful work!!!

After a while the meat is looking like that, very small :-)
Then we mix the all thing with some salt!
I have done this part too, this is great :-)










Ok now we cut the dough in small part.
each small part will be then rolled and cut.










We put them in some flour again.

So this one is a buzz to be cooked like a dumpling
This one (different form) is a kushur, to be cooked in oil
I prefer this one (more fatty :-))
This is the buzz machine
impressive, no?
After 25 minutes you are ready to eat tons of buzz.

oh you can make also a small version of buzz,  I call them mini buzz but actually this is bansch (or something like that!!)
